Solving All the Problems with systemd
Offered By: USENIX via YouTube
Course Description
Overview
Explore the powerful capabilities of systemd for service management in this comprehensive USENIX conference talk. Discover how to leverage the best aspects of traditional service management and containerization, allowing for flexible and secure deployment options. Learn techniques for packaging dependencies, managing network access, and restricting file system access while maintaining ease of service management. Dive into advanced systemd features, including service isolation, socket and path activation, watchdog functionality, and task scheduling. Gain insights on handling service failures and maximizing systemd's potential on your Linux server. Whether you're a system administrator or a curious developer, this talk provides valuable knowledge to enhance your service deployment strategies.
Syllabus
Intro
What is a service manager
Your own service manager
Why systemd
How systemd works
Templates
How it works
Cool things you can do
Protect Home
Taught by
USENIX
Related Courses
Named Data NetworkingUSENIX via YouTube Release Engineering Best Practices at Google
USENIX via YouTube Efficiently Backing Up Terabytes of Data with PgBackRest
USENIX via YouTube SRE in the Small and in the Large
USENIX via YouTube Network-Based LUKS Volume Decryption with Tang
USENIX via YouTube